Parties' aid, immigration, defence promises lamented for ambiguity

Even experts say they have a hard time figuring out each party's position.
Published April 20, 2011

The economy and health care inevitably dominate Canadian elections. And pollsters inevitably say that foreign affairs and international issues are non-issues that don't influence what the final result will be.

But despite such generalizations, there are specific blocs of voters for whom party promises on immigration, military and foreign aid are more important than anything else they will say. And for...
